I’M Not A Punching Bag, Chellah tells Critics

ChellahPresident Michael Sata’s spokesperson, George Chellah, says he will not sit idle and watch himself become a punching bag for scumbags following attacks on his person by ex-gospel singer Sidique Geloo.

Geloo, widely known in Lusaka circles following his singing ministry at Dan Pule’s Dunamis Christian Centre, caused the publication of a stinging attack on Chellah on the Zambian Watchdog and other social media network such as Facebook.

Sidique’s article headlined; Chellah and his blind loyalty to Kabimba branded the President’s spokesperson a stooge of the chief justice alleging the ex-Post Newspaper reporter had taken sides in the wrangles that had engulfed the ruling Patriotic Front.

Chellah was prompted to respond to the litany of allegations laid bare through a comment on his private facebook page which is occasionally on and off depending on the political heat.

“I like SIDIQUE GELOO for one thing; he has an exceptional flair of narrating events that never took place. He is a fraud, a gifted con artist and knows how to woo gullible minds.

“He descriptively writes and talks about me like we have ever met or even exchanged a greeting.

“Not that I care, but it troubles me to see such amounts of oomph getting wasted on sheer pettiness and immaturity.

“Get down to work Sidique, hating me won’t make you any better; it can only annoy you even further.

“It’s not wise to originate and be taken by your own propaganda. That’s mental lethargy!”

But when one of his friends Prody Kabamba advised him not to responded to “hateful” and “unfounded allegations” while keeping his temper cool more so that he was considered a role model, Chellah responded; “Am actually very calm. There comes a time when public figures gat to speak too. Public office won’t make me a punch bag for scumbags like Sidique.”

He further threatened Geloo with legal action in like manner one of President Michael Sata’s ministers and nephew Miles Sampa took action against a defunct gossip-based online publication Kachepa360.com.

Chellah said he would not hesitate to follow Geloo to Atlanta where he is based and currently leader of the Zambian Association based in that part of the United States of America.

“If he pushes his luck too far, I will handle him the way Hon. Miles Sampa dealt with KACHEPA 360. I will hit him with litigation right in ATLANTA, his base.

“This I promise and let him try me! The American society he squats in does not condone this pathetic lunacy he offloads online every day,” Chellah roared.

In another response when it looked certain Zambia Music Association president Maiko Zulu was attempting to pacify the tension among the warring parties, Chellah stated Geloo had raised serious allegations against his character.

“What he posted on ZPP wasn’t a debate. He was raising very serious allegations about my character and professional standing…of which he shall justify at some point if he continues with this immaturity and time-wasting antics,” he stated.

A seemingly brave friend Chishimba Chimba, who broke away from the praises Chellah was showered for dressing down his online nemesis Geloo, reminded the president’s spokesperson of his role as a reporter at The Post where he alleged fabricated news stories.

“Trading places Ba George. Remember your days at The Post Newspaper…The hunter, now the hunted…!!! Trading places,” Chimba stated but Chellah said; “I never wrote what [I] can’t defend, that’s the difference.”

Chellah and Geloo are not new to online spats have both clashed when the former, allegedly using a pseudo facebook account under the Saviour Kayula brand, attacked the latter’s alleged promiscuous lifestyle when he was a choir master at Pule’s church.
